COSMOS/M and COSMOS/DesignStar Training

COSMOS/M Basic - 3 days

An introduction to the COSMOS/M Finite Element Analysis program for engineers with or without previous experience of FEA programs.
Skills: Pre-processor Model generation, meshing considerations, linear static and linear dynamic solutions, results interpretation and quality assessment.
Pre-requisite: Working understanding of problems to be solved.

COSMOS/M Advanced Dynamic Analysis - 2 days

Introduction to analysing the effects of periodic and shock loads represented by time - history data, harmonic loads, random vibration and response spectra.
Skills: Interpreting input data to determine optimum analysis type, optimising analysis options, results interpretation and quality assessments.
Pre-requisite: COSMOS/M basic course.

COSMOS/M Nonlinear Analysis - 2 days

Introduction to analysing non-linear effects.
Skills: Analysing gap/contact conditions, large displacement effects, non-linear material models.
Pre-requisite: COSMOS/M basic course.

COSMOS/M Thermal Analysis - 1 day

Introduction to Steady State and Transient thermal analyses.
Skills: Boundary condition considerations, optimising analysis options.
Pre-requisite: COSMOS/M basic course.

COSMOS/DesignStar Basic - 2 days

An introduction to the Finite Element Analysis method, use of the DesignStar interface, and hands-on tutorial session.
Skills: Model generation, meshing considerations, linear static, dynamic solutions, results interpretation and quality assessment.
Pre-requisite: Working understanding of problems to be solved.

COSMOS/DesignStar Thermal Analysis - 1 day

Introduction to Steady State and Transient thermal analyses.
Skills: Boundary condition considerations, optimising analysis options.
Pre-requisite: COSMOS/DesignStar basic course.

COSMOS/DesignStar Nonlinear Analysis - 1 day

Introduction to analysing non-linear effects.
Skills: Analysing large displacement effects, non-linear material models.
Pre-requisite: COSMOS/DesignStar basic course.
